Transaction 93fe75fb5daf5684589cecc1c9383bb54dcf46e85298e13c6c73d17a136a0269
1 Input
1 Output
-
93fe75fb5daf5684589cecc1c9383bb54dcf46e85298e13c6c73d17a136a0269:0
- value
- 30334472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a68daa70c8185624eebbbda7fa320cbaa871a4b OP_EQUAL
- address
- 3HE4QYe3WUQhE8JDE1PHA9DNyXc9fmUU6R